原文:((void *) 0)的含义和void的一些细节

一 在c语言中, 是一个特殊的值,它可以表示:整型数值 ,空字符,逻辑假 false 。表示的东西多了,有时候不好判断。尤其是空字符和数字 之间。 为了明确的指出, 是空字符的含义,用用到了: void 这个表达式。表示把 强制转换为空字符,不管以前代表的什么含义。 在c的标准头文件中,就是这样定义NULL的: 关于void在指针的应用: void表示 无类型 ,void 表示无类型指针。在定义指 ...

2017-10-07 17:14 0 6892 推荐指数:

查看详情

typedef void (*funcptr)(void)的含义

fun a;//等价于void (*a)(); 这样声明起来就方便多了 void (*a)();表示a是个指针,指向一个不带参数、返回值为空的函数    定义一个函数指针类型。 比如你有三个函数: void hello(void) { printf("你好 ...

Sat Jun 08 08:09:00 CST 2019 0 660
javascript:void(0)的含义

void关键字介绍   首先,void关键字是javascript当中非常重要的关键字,该操作符指定要计算或运行一个表达式,但是不返回值。   语法格式: void func() void(func()) 实例1   当点击超级链接时,什么都不 ...

Sat Jun 29 04:54:00 CST 2019 2 45110
voidvoid指针含义的深刻解析

void含义 void即“无类型”,void *则为“无类型指针”,能够指向不论什么数据类型。void指针使用规范①void指针能够指向随意类型的数据,亦就可以用随意数据类型的指针对void指针赋值。比如:int * pint;void *pvoid;pvoid = pint ...

Mon Jul 28 02:18:00 CST 2014 0 3047
void类型及void指针

1.概述 许多初学者对C/C 语言中的voidvoid指针类型不甚理解,因此在使用上出现了一些错误。本文将对void关键字的深刻含义进行解说,并 详述voidvoid指针类型的使用方法与技巧。 2.void含义 void的字面意思是“无类型”,void *则为“无类型指针”,void ...

Tue Mar 20 09:23:00 CST 2012 3 26991
void (*pFunction)(void);

typedef void (*pFunction)(void); JumpAddress = *(__IO uint32_t*) (DEF_FLASH_AppStartaddr + 4); Jump_To_Application = (pFunction ...

Sun Apr 09 02:34:00 CST 2017 0 2548
void类型和void* 的用法

C语言中的voidvoid * 总结 1、void的作用   c语言中,void为“不确定类型”,不可以用void来声明变量。如:void a = 10;如果出现这样语句编译器会报错:variable or field ‘a’ declared void。   在C语言中void ...

Tue Dec 19 01:37:00 CST 2017 7 60391
【转】 voidvoid*详解

void关键字的使用规则: 1. 如果函数没有返回值,那么应声明为void类型; 2. 如果函数无参数,那么应声明其参数为void; 3. 如果函数的参数可以是任意类型指针,那么应声明其参数为void ...

Wed Sep 21 03:55:00 CST 2016 0 19700
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M